The Reserve Bank officially announced that the OCR is going up by a further 75 basis points to 4.25 percent, the highest level since 2008. Jenee Tibshraeny, NZ Herald Wellington business editor says that this news isn't surprising, but this rate hike may not even be the worst of it. Jenee Tibshraeny says that the financial markets were more shocked by the lack of growth potential paired with the rate hike, and the fact that it could lead to a recession by next year. A Hokitika man considers himself lucky to tell the tale of being struck by lightning yesterday afternoon and his ute bursting into flames. The lightning bolt hit the bonnet of Caleb Harris' ute. Joshua Goldend saw Harris’ ute burning and said a man directing traffic told him about the strike. The air near a lightning strike, meanwhile, is heated to 27,760C - hotter than the surface of the sun – and the rapid heating and cooling of air near the lightning channel causes a shock wave that results in thunder. While lightning strikes kill an estimated 6000 to 24,000 people around the world each year, lightning fatalities and injuries are incredibly rare in New Zealand – with just a few dozen claims to ACC over the past two decades.

Photo: Supplied via LDRKiwiRail wants feedback on new train stations in Drury and Paerātā which it says will cater for the area's rapidly growing population. But KiwiRail has been stuck in a legal battle with developer Charles Ma over the location of the third station in Drury West. The Drury Central and Paerātā station park and rides will contain up to 350 parking spaces each, while the Dury West station will have up to 200. Matt Lowrie is the editor of transport and urban design blog Greater Auckland and said KiwiRail's design for the Drury Central station needed work. Photo: Supplied via LDRThe station's park and ride should instead be moved north of Waihoehoe Rd and those using it should be charged, he said.

The house owner has acted smartly by adding a complimentary Tesla electric car worth $60,000 to their home purchase. According to Sky News, house prices have dropped for 11 straight months and by the most in 30 years in October. For the eleventh consecutive month, New Zealand house prices fell 10.9% in October, the most significant monthly decline in 30 years. “Rising mortgage rates continue to weigh on house prices and sale activity,” said Kiwibank economists in a note. Many experts believe that even though the cash rate is predicted to increase, housing prices will continue to decline.

The super-yacht is named after Pangea, the supercontinent that existed millions of centuries ago during the late Paleozoic and early Mesozoic eras. That's the latest concept from Lazzarini, the Italian design firm, which showcased its layout for Pangeos, a floating city that could become the world's largest boat. Pangeos will be approximately 1,800 feet long and 2,000 feet wide. Pangeos' wings will be intended to extract energy from the sea's waves, allowing it to cruise indefinitely without emitting greenhouse gases. While sailing, the large wings will gain energy from the breaking of the waves and Pangeos will cruise perpetually without emissions around the planet Earth's seas.

A third Covid wave is currently sweeping over the country. You can tell it by empty offices, the coughs you hear on public transport and the surge in case numbers. Otago University epidemiologist professor Michael Baker tells The Front Page podcast numbers have been tracking up over the last eight weeks and we are facing a “swarm of variants” moving through society. The Manawatu District Council last week responded to the lack of Government-mandated restrictions by imposing Covid rules on staff amid the latest outbreak.
